Start out with warm water up to top of their legs then as they get use to that each day you can make it deeper so they can dive. They live to dive. They will produce their own oil as they begin to peen and you’ll see them start after their first bath . They have an oil gland right at the base of their tail where it’s meets the body they will rub their heads on it and oil their bodies. Just always stay with them when they are in the water. They will have a blast and you’ll enjoy watching them. They will show you by observation when they are ready to get out or get them out before water cools off.

My younger ones do this. I sit with them with something they like. For me it is a warm breakfast mash. They are now coming up and trying to untie my shoe laces as I clean their brooder.

My older ones it took them a day to remember me after I moved them outside . If you can sit and peep at them while having food it should help. Their slow critters.

Took a lot of treats to get there I started with peas them moved to meal worms. Now grapes are a favorite. They don’t like me picking them up but will let me pet them if I sit down with them.

The way to my ducks heart was through their stomach.
